You can make the “V” close together or as far apart as you’d like. … Web21 Mar 2024 · There are three basic types of interfacing: woven, non-woven and knit interfacing. White woven interfacing. Woven is, just as the name suggests, woven fabric that can come in several different weights and colours. Non-woven is generally made by bonding or felting fibres together without any specific direction or grainline.
